The Leeds Rhinos are a professional rugby league club in Leeds, West Yorkshire, England. The club play their home games at AMT Headingley Rugby Stadium and compete in the Super League, the top tier of British rugby league.

Leeds Rhinos have won the League Championship 11 times, Challenge Cup 14 times and World Club Challenge three times.

The club share big long-standing West Yorkshire Derby rivalries with Huddersfield Giants and Bradford Bulls as well as a cross city rivalry with Hunslet. Leeds' traditional home colours are blue and amber shirts with white shorts and blue socks.
